ABSTRACT

The rapid ongoing digital transformation creates new opportunities to generate value but also challenges companies in the manufacturing industry to adapt to the recent changes. Moreover, committing to sustainability is essential to maintain competitive advantages, build a more resilient company, and manage increasing societal demands and regulations. Referred to as a “twin transition”, the digital transformation can positively impact firms’ commitments to environmental sustainability. This paper explores challenges that small technology solution providers face on their path toward developing sustainable production solutions for their manufacturing customers. An empirical study was conducted in an industrial cluster of small and medium-sized companies (SMEs) providing innovative, tailor-made production technology solutions to manufacturing companies. As a result, a collaborative process model was suggested for such SMEs to overcome internal and external barriers to obtaining sustainability, thus better supporting the manufacturing companies, i.e., their customers, to strive towards more sustainable production.

ABSTRACT

A 35-year-old diabetic woman was referred to the emergency department with fever, left flank pain, pneumaturia, and impaired vision of the left eye from 4 days ago. Fever, tachycardia, tachypnea, low blood pressure, metabolic acidosis, and azotemia were the first findings. The diagnosis was a coincidence of emphysematous pyelonephritis and emphysematous endophthalmitis due to computerized tomography of the patient. Immediate fluid and electrolytes resuscitation, intravenous antibiotic administration, and nephrectomy save the patient. Urine, blood, and vitreous cultures revealed mixed germ infection.
